Jeezus 05-17-08 01:39 AM


Originally Posted by StumpDrummer (Post 8199647)
Jeez

Its got balanced rotors 3mm cryoed apex seals
very nice street port --built by atkins rotary
and 2 big assed yellow coils

3mm steel? Carbon? Ceramic? Cyroed or not, Steel is steel. Steel will chatter over 8400-8500RPM.

Get ceramic seals, hardened Stationary gears, 3 window bearings, 3rd gen corner springs, balanced rotating assembly, oil pressure mods, clearenced rotors, scatter shield for transmission, set screws in the rotor bearings, etc etc.
